1. Screen size
One of the first things to consider when choosing a TV is the screen size. The ideal screen size depends on the viewing distance and the layout of the room in which the TV is placed. In general, a larger screen makes for a more immersive viewing experience, but it's important to avoid having the screen too big for the room and potentially missing out on details.
2. Resolution
The resolution of a TV refers to the number of pixels that can be displayed on the screen. The higher the resolution, the sharper and more detailed the image will be. The most common resolutions are Full HD (1080p), 4K Ultra HD (2160p) and 8K Ultra HD. When choosing a TV, it's important to consider the quality of the source material you usually watch. If you mainly watch HD content, a Full HD TV will suffice, but if you want to enjoy the best picture quality, a 4K TV is the best choice.
3. Image quality
In addition to resolution, there are other factors that affect a TV's picture quality. Some important aspects to consider are contrast ratio, brightness, color reproduction and viewing angles. A TV with a high contrast ratio provides deeper blacks and more vibrant colors, while a higher brightness improves visibility in well-lit areas. It is also important to check whether the TV supports a wide color spectrum for realistic color reproduction. In addition, it is useful to know how the TV performs at different viewing angles, especially if you have a large room in which people will be watching the TV from different positions.
4. Smart features
Many modern TVs come with smart features, giving you access to various streaming apps, internet browsers and other online content. This can be useful if you like to stream movies and TV series or if you want to use your TV to surf the internet. When choosing a TV, it is important to check which smart features are offered and whether they meet your needs. Some TVs even have voice control or artificial intelligence features, allowing you to control the TV with your voice or get suggestions based on your viewing habits.

6. Connections
Before you buy a TV, it is important to check which connections are available. Make sure the TV has enough HDMI ports to connect all your devices, such as a set-top box, game console, and media player. In addition, it may be useful to check if the TV has other connections, such as USB ports, Ethernet ports, and optical audio ports, depending on your specific needs.
